Lakeview Lodge Trail offers three different loops, each progressively more difficult. You will embark on Loop 1 and will eventually reach a fork in the road. At the fork, proceed right (west) to continue onto loop 2, approximately 1.75 mi long. To continue on Loop 1, proceed left (south) to return to where you started.
This is a family-friendly hiking trail that is tucked away and not heavily trafficked. It offers a peaceful and easy hike through the forest with stunning views of the lake. However, after heavy rainfall, the trail can be muddy, making it challenging to navigate. There are sections of uphill and downhill terrain mixed with flat areas. The trail system has several interconnecting trails for those who want to extend their journey.
